Block #18666

Block Hash
eac2b91fab850a99a0c1c02ecfe5d302bad9e93dbae80414cda9d29348bb9bbd
Previous Block
Merkle Root
4919c891...7e5d01d0
Timestamp
(3 days ago)
Difficulty
0.02517043
Size
2,505 bytes
Nonce
9533

Transactions 2

Transaction ID Size
98a1ff66...9bae25fe 279 bytes
0106f0c8...646dbc3a 2,145 bytes